身体活動と心血管疾患のリスク低下:潜在的な仲介メカニズム

まとめ
定期的な身体活動は,心血管疾患 (CVD) のリスクを大幅に低下させます. この利点は,主に炎症マーカーと血圧の改善によって説明され,CVD予防の重要なメカニズムを強調しています.

背景:
- より高い身体活動レベルは,心血管疾患 (CVD) イベントの減少と関連しています.
- この関連性の正確なメカニズムは完全に理解されていません.
- 心血管疾患のリスク要因は,仲介的な役割を果たす可能性があります.
研究 の 目的:
- 身体活動とCVDの関係における様々な危険因子の仲介的役割を調査する.
- 異なるリスク要因が観察された逆関連に与える影響を定量化する.
主な方法:
- 27,055人の健康な女性を対象に,平均10.9年の追跡期間で実施した前向きな研究.
- ヘモグロビンA1c,脂質,クレアチニン,ホモシステイン,および炎症性/静血性バイオマーカーの基準値の測定.
- 自己報告した身体活動,体重,身長,高血圧,糖尿病を評価した.
主要な成果:
- 心血管疾患のリスクは,身体活動の増加とともに線形的に減少した.
- 既知の危険因子の差異は,逆相関の59.0%を説明した.
- 炎症性/血静性バイオマーカー (32.6%) と血圧 (27.1%) は,リスク低下に最も大きく貢献した.
結論:
- 身体活動とCVDリスクの間の逆関連は,既知の危険因子によって実質的に媒介されます.
- 炎症性/静血性因子と血圧が重要な媒介因子である.
- 新規の脂質,BMI,およびヘモグロビンA1c/糖尿病も寄与したが,ホモシステインとクレアチニンは最小限の影響を及ぼした.
